HC Deb 21 February 1905 vol 141 c756
MR. REGINALD LUCAS (Portsmouth)

To ask the Secretary to the Admiralty whether any provision exists for bestowing rewards for meritorious service upon petty officers in the Royal Navy, corresponding to those granted to non-commissioned officers in the Army and Marines; and, if not, whether he can hold out any hope of considering the matter.

(Answered by Mr. Pretyman.) There is no such provision made for petty officers in the Royal Navy. This is one of many differences between the conditions of service and privileges in the Army and the Navy, and it is not proposed to make any change.
